So I have a TON of characters here and there that have yet to be realized. One of them who keeps popping up is this graveyard stalker I call Tiffany the Skull Cat. She's been with me a while(even when originally she was a he, and that became her older brother) Anyway, her deal is that part of a race of cat people who were created by witches AND scientists to monitor and keep in check any criminal magic activity (whatever that may be, like unlawfully using a necronomicon to shoplift or something). And there are specific groups or clans that specialize in certain fields of illicit sorcery. Her specialty is necromancy or anything involving the undead. She is trained to hunt zombies, ghosts, mummies, whatever was supposedly not to be reanimated, but was. And sometimes it doesn't fall under sorcery. She dispatches the undead and puts them in a special burial ground that ends undead life. There's a lot to go into here. But she takes on the affectation of a NYC punk rocker. Has a mohawk. Fights with a special shovel and axe. Doesn't go into much for spells and whatnot(she's no nerd she'll say) preferring to street-fight her enemies claw to hand as it were. Real blue-collar vibe to her. Also a flirty lesbian, because why not? Not much afraid of anything, rarely backs down.
